Following the prevailing high cost of living in the country, the Federal Government of Nigeria has approved an increase of between 25% and 35% salary increment for Civil Servants on the remaining six Consolidated Salary Structures. A statement signed by the Head of Press of the National Salaries, Incomes and Wages Commission (NSIWC), Emmanuel Njoku, said the increases take effect from 1st January 2024 The statement added that the government has also approved increases in pension of between 20% and 28% on the Defined Benefits Scheme with respect to the six consolidated salary structures with effect from 1st January 2024.
